Popunder Ads Explained: A Deep Dive
Popunder ads have become a rather unique form of online advertising. Unlike conventional display ads, which appear on web pages visually, popunder ads emerge in a new browser window behind the current tab or page. This positioning makes them less disruptive than some other ad formats, but they can still be effective at grabbing user attention and driving traffic to websites.

What is a Popunder Ad? Everything You Need to Know
Popunder ads are a type of online advertisement that show up in a new window beneath the main browser window. Unlike other ad formats like banner or pop-up ads, popunders load after you interact with a particular webpage. They are often placed on websites with high traffic and can be quite effective in reaching target audiences.
- Here's some key characteristics of popunder ads:
- They are less intrusive than traditional pop-up ads, which often frustrate users.
- They may achieve higher click-through rates (CTR) than other ad formats due to their placement and design.
- They usually come in relatively inexpensive to implement.
Although, popunder ads can sometimes be perceived as intrusive by users. It's important for advertisers to use them carefully and ensure that they provide benefit to the user experience.
